When something does not load.
Check the broadcaster’s live schedule and account requirements first. A channel that is off-air or unavailable to your account will not be fixed by changing VPN routes.
If ABC does not permit VPN connections, disconnect Dash before using the service. For other connection problems, see the Dash FAQ or contact support with the error and selected route.

Does Dash include a ABC subscription?
No. Dash supplies the VPN connection. You still need to meet ABC’s account, payment, and access requirements.
What if ABC is not in Dash’s Services list?
The available shortcuts can change. Use Fastest in Regions for a general connection where permitted; this does not guarantee compatibility with a particular service.
Can a VPN guarantee access?
No. Providers may restrict VPNs and control their own licensing and eligibility. Follow local law and the service’s terms.
